Common Plumbing Emergencies
Pipes Burst Pipes
The causes of burst pipes
The majority of burst pipes are caused by freezing temperatures, aging pipes or high pressure water.
Signs of burst pipes
Signs of burst pipes include low pressure in the water, odd noises coming from pipes, wet spots on walls or ceilings, and a decline in the quality of water.
What should you do in the event of a burst pipe
If you suspect a burst pipe, shut off the main water supply immediately , and seek out an experienced plumber.
Clogged Drains
Causes of clogged drains
Clogged drains are usually caused by buildup of hair or soap scum and other sludge in pipes.
Signs of blocked drains
Signs of clogged drains include slower draining of the water, noises coming from pipes, as well as foul smells.
What to do in case of a drain that is clogged
Try using a plunger or a drain snake to free the drain. If none of these solutions work, contact a professional plumber.
Leaking Fixtures
Leaks in fixtures are caused by a variety of reasons.
Leaking fixtures are usually caused by worn or damaged components.
Evidence of fixtures that are leaking
The signs of leaking fixtures are drips, damp spots on ceilings or walls, and an abrupt increase in water bills.
What to do in the event of a leaky fixture
Try tightening any loose connections or replacing damaged parts. If that doesn’t resolve the problem, call an experienced plumber.
Gas Leaks
Causes of gas leaks
Gas leaks are typically caused due to damaged pipes or defective gas appliances.
Signs of gas leaks
The signs of gas leaks include a hissing or whistling sound close to gas appliances, a rotten egg smell, as well as dizziness or headaches.
What to do in case of the possibility of a gas leak
If you suspect that there is a gas leak, you should evacuate the home as soon as you notice a gas leak and then call an expert plumber.

Prevention Tips
Regular maintenance of plumbing
Regular maintenance of plumbing can reduce the risk of plumbing problems by identifying and fixing minor issues before they become bigger ones.
Simple steps to avoid common plumbing problems
Simple ways to prevent common plumbing problems include using drain screens, refraining from dissolving the grease into drains, and avoid flushing items that are not flushable into the toilet.
When should you schedule plumbing inspections?
Schedule plumbing inspections annually or bi-annually to identify and correct potential problems before they turn into emergencies.
